Pew Internet & American Life Project The Pew Internet & American Life Project is a non-profit, non-partisan organization funded by the Pew Charitable Trusts to assess the social impact of the internet on individuals, families and communities. The easy-to-navigate site features reports, trending information and presentations about consumers’ online activities and habits.
